      What to Expect (Job Responsibilities):
      - Communicate effectively with physician and pharmacy network providers to address their needs and inquiries
      - Evaluate and direct daily workflow within the department regarding drug benefit design inquiries
      - Review prior authorization criteria for drug products and prioritize requests
      - Document all authorizations and denials accurately in accordance with state and federal regulations
      - Participate in onsite member appeals and grievance sessions as a pharmacy representative

      What is Required (Qualifications):
      - High school diploma or GED
      - Experience in pharmacy prescription claims processing/submission/payment
      - Familiarity with multiple Medicaid and Medicare drug benefit design offerings and regulations
      - Excellent computer skills, including knowledge of Microsoft Outlook, Word, and OnBase
      - Strong organizational skills and attention to detail

      How to Stand Out (Preferred Qualifications):
      - Associate degree
      - Pharmacy technician certification
      - Experience in managed care medication formulary management
      - Working knowledge of retail pharmacy and third-party prescription processing
      - Strong background and understanding of medications and formulary terminology
